The Rev. Richard A. Macon, 84, died on Friday, October 22, 2010 at the Golden Living Center.
He was born in Chester, S.C., and was the son of Isaiah and Mozella Macon. He was preceded in death by Minnie, his wife of 46 years, and daughter, Doris Wilson.
He was a veteran of World War II, having served in the U.S. Navy from 1944 to 1946. He served as pastor of several churches in North Carolina and South Carolina. He was a member and associate pastor at First Baptist Church-West of Charlotte.
